The discovery that imido analogs Of actinyl dioxo cations can be extended beyond uranium into the transuranic elements is presented. Synthesis of the Np(V) Complex, Np(NDipp)(2)(tBu(2)bipy)(2)Cl (1), is achieved through treatment of a Np (IV) precursor with a bipyridine coligand and lithium-amide reagent. Complex 1 has been structurally characterized, analyzed by H-1 NMR and UV-vis-NIR spectroscopies, and the electronic structure evaluated by DFT calculations.
